MCUs have 2-partition, single flash block architecture.

Press Release Summary:



Leveraging SuperFlash technology, SST89E52RC and SST89E54RC microcontrollers (MCUs) feature 8 or 16 KB primary and 1 KB secondary independent program memory partitions. In-system programming and in-application programming function allows for in-field re-programming of flash memory code. In addition to entire block programming time of less than 2.2 sec and page-level security locks, 8-bit 8051-compatible MCUs feature 512 Bytes of RAM and operate at 33 MHz clock speed.

SST Introduces Two-Partition, Single Flash Block Devices to Its FlashFlex51 Microcontroller Family



SuperFlash-Based Microcontrollers Are Ideal Solutions for High-Volume Consumer Applications Market

SUNNYVALE, Calif., Aug. 14 -- SST (Silicon Storage Technology, Inc.), (NASDAQ:SSTI), a leader in flash memory technology, today announced the availability of its next-generation FlashFlex51 family of 8-bit, 8051-compatible microcontrollers. Leveraging the company's proprietary SuperFlash technology, the new SST89E52RC and SST89E54RC microcontrollers feature a single flash block architecture with two independent program memory partitions. The devices also feature an in-system programming (ISP) and in-application programming (IAP) function that enables users to re-program the flash memory code in the field. The SST89E52/54RC microcontroller products are used in a wide range of high-volume applications including audio amplifiers and other digital consumer devices. SST's two-partition, single-block SuperFlash MCUs with fast entire block programming time (<2.2s), in-field re-programmability and unique page security offer high reliability, lower system costs and expedite system development cycles.

The single flash block architecture of the SST89E5xRC series of FlashFlex51 microcontrollers is partitioned into an 8 KByte or 16 KByte primary partition plus a 1 KByte secondary partition. In addition, the devices feature 512 Bytes of RAM and operate at a 33MHz clock speed.

In-Field Re-Programmability Through IAP and ISP

Like all of SST's FlashFlex51 microcontrollers, the RC series supports both IAP and ISP, enabling the user to update the flash device in the field or in an application. Both IAP and ISP lower cost and improve time-to-market for manufacturers, while bringing enhanced user experiences and convenience to consumers. These re-programming features also have a significant role in enabling increased functionality, such as remote diagnostics and product monitoring, in network- or Internet-enabled devices.

The SST89E52/54RC microcontrollers feature page-level security locks for added protection. The page-level security locks improve the overall security level of the application and improve the flexibility of data storage. Additional features within the devices include a programmable Watchdog Timer (WDT), one enhanced UART, a double clock mode option and a selectable operation clock.

Pricing and Availability

The SST89E54RC and SST89E52RC microcontrollers are available now. Pricing for the SST89E54RC is $1.10 and pricing for the SST89E52RC is $0.90, each in 10K unit quantities. For additional information, visit SST's Web site at www.sst.com/ .
